The annual salary statistics of laundry and dry-cleaning workers in Punta Gorda, Florida is shown in Table 1. The wage data of laundry and dry-cleaning workers in Punta Gorda is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$22,140 |
25th Percentile Wage | $22,490 |
50th Percentile Wage | $26,300 |
75th Percentile Wage | $28,200 |
90th Percentile Wage | $31,860 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for laundry and dry-cleaning workers in Punta Gorda, Florida in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$31,860.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$26,300.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$22,140.
